There could be a multitude of reasons why there is "no amount" shown on your refund. If your sole or main income is social security, then you might not qualify for a refund. However, it could also be a glitch in the TurboTax's system because TurboTax has nothing to do with the amount of your refund, or when it will be distributed.
That being said, my best advise would be to reach out to the IRS and see if you can view a transcript/copy of your return. The copy they provide you with should have your correct amount of your return on it. The instructions on how to find that are listed below:
Track your federal refund at the IRS Where's My Refund site. If your refund status shows as received (being processed) and it's been less than 21 days, hang in there, this is normal. (More Info)
It can take up to 3 weeks for your refund to move into Approved status. This time-frame is unrelated to how quickly you got your refund last year."
